The Cosmic Journey ContinuesThe second chapter in Gong's legendary Radio Gnome Invisible trilogy, Angel's Egg takes the story deeper into the surreal, otherworldly universe first introduced on Flying Teapot. Originally released in 1973, the album follows the continuing adventures of Zero the Hero and the Pot Head Pixies, expanding Daevid Allen's visionary mythology into an even more ambitious world of flying teapots, cosmic transmissions, spiritual awakening, and playful rebellion.Musically, Angel's Egg pushes Gong's unique fusion of psychedelic rock, progressive experimentation, jazz improvisation, and anarchic humour into new territory. With it's hypnotic grooves, swirling synthesizers, gliding guitars, saxophone excursions, and eccentric vocal characters, the album moves effortlessly between the playful and the profound. Featuring cult favourites including "Other Side of the Sky," "Oily Way," "Flute Salad," and "You Can't Kill Me," it captures Gong's classic line-up at their most imaginative, adventurous, and otherworldly.Remastered from the original BYG Records tapes and cut at half-speed at the UK's world-famous Stardelta Studios by Grammy Award-winning mastering engineer Lewis Hopkin, this deluxe reissue delivers the album with exceptional depth, clarity, and detail. The LP is housed in a faithful reproduction of the original gatefold sleeve, while the CD edition recreates the gatefold artwork in a special deluxe format. Both editions include a 16-page booklet faithfully replicating Daevid Allen's original 1973 guide to the characters, stories and mythology of the Radio Gnome Invisible saga.
